The Archivist is responsible for managing all aspects of local documentation archiving across on-site, external and electronic archives. The incumbent ensures documentation, records and information related to GMP manufacturing processes are accurately and securely maintained, accessible, and that data integrity is protected throughout record lifecycles. Documentation is correctly classified, indexed and retained compliantly according to required retention periods, and compliance with EU GMP, data integrity, biosafety, HSE, BI Global/Local SOPs and EU Directive 2001/82/EC is maintained. Tasks & Responsibilities

  • Oversight of Local Archive
    • Ownership & management of local procedures related to the archive.
    • Regular archiving of GxP documents.
    • Manage entry/retrieval of documents.
    • Ensure access control, safekeeping and key control.
    • Identify key archiving attributes and support record retention assignment.
    • Orchestrate the document reconciliation process.
    • Ensure orderly storage of records.
    • Control/document movement of records.
    • Conduct periodic spot checks of retrieval time.
    • Maintain stock of archiving consumables.
    • Destroy records after the retention period.
    • Retrieve documents timely for audits/inspections.
    • Continuously improve the archiving process.
    • Train individuals and users in true copy generation and archiving.
  • Oversight of External Archive
    • Manage storage/retrieval of documents to an off-site facility.
    • Manage annual purchase orders.
    • Oversee destruction of records after the retention period.
    • Act as SME for external archive audits (e-DMS Archivist).
    • Move obsolete/retired documents to the archive folder in VQD and delete them at the end of the retention period.
  • Audits & Inspections
    • Ensure audit/inspection readiness.
    • Organise and prepare documentation for audits/inspections.
    • Participate and support during regulatory inspections, global quality audits and internal audits.
